Single Hinged Expansion Joints

Single hinged expansion joints, also known as single hinge expansion joints, are specialized components used in piping systems to accommodate angular movement in a single plane. Here’s an overview of single hinged expansion joints:

  1. Purpose: Single hinged expansion joints are designed to absorb angular movement or rotation in one plane while maintaining the integrity and alignment of the piping system. They provide flexibility and allow for movement in a single direction, typically either horizontally or vertically.

  2. Construction: These expansion joints consist of a bellows element connected to the adjacent piping sections by hinge hardware. The bellows, often made of metal (such as stainless steel), are corrugated tubes designed to flex and accommodate angular movement. The hinge hardware allows the bellows to pivot and rotate, providing flexibility in a single plane.

  3. Flexibility: Single hinged expansion joints offer flexibility in a single plane, allowing for angular movement or rotation in one direction between connected piping sections. The bellows element can pivot around the hinge point to absorb angular displacement while maintaining the alignment and integrity of the piping system.

  4. Compensation for Angular Movement: Single hinged expansion joints are specifically designed to compensate for angular movement or rotation in one plane between connected piping sections. This movement may result from thermal expansion, settlement of supporting structures, ground movement, or other dynamic forces acting on the piping system.

  5. Application: Single hinged expansion joints are commonly used in piping systems where angular movement occurs predominantly in one direction, such as pipelines connected to equipment with rotational motion or in systems subjected to unidirectional thermal expansion or contraction.

  6. Installation and Maintenance: Proper installation and maintenance are essential for the reliable performance of single hinged expansion joints. Installation should follow manufacturer guidelines, including proper alignment and support of the expansion joint. Regular inspection and maintenance help identify potential issues such as leaks, fatigue, or corrosion, allowing for timely repairs or replacements.

Single hinged expansion joints provide an effective solution for accommodating angular movement in a single plane between connected piping sections while maintaining system integrity and alignment. Proper selection and installation of these expansion joints are crucial to ensure the efficient operation and longevity of the piping system.
